Bollworm is the major insect pest of Chickpea in Ethiopia. Field experiment was conducted at Sirinka and Cheffa research sites during 2022 main growing season to determine the appropriate rate and spraying frequency of Indoxacarb insecticide and select cost-effective management options of bollworm. A randomized complete block design was implemented with three replications. The combination of three rates and three spraying frequencies of indoxacarb insecticide and unsprayed treatments was evaluated. The lowest (0.27 and 0.03) mean larva number were scored from plots treated 0.75 L with three times spraying frequency at Sirinka and Cheffa respectively. The lowest (1606 and 1269 kg ha-1) chickpea seed yield was found from untreated control plots. Similarly, the highest (2956 and 2835 kg ha-1) seed yield was obtained from plots treated with 0.75 L rates with two and three times spraying frequencies at Sirinka and Cheffa respectively. However the highest (804.4%) marginal rate of return was obtained from plots treated 0.5 L with two times spraying. Generally, 0.5 liter with two times spraying of indoxacarb was effective in controlling bollworm and got the highest cost-benefit advantage as compared with other treatments. Therefore, it could be recommended for the management of chickpea bollworm in the study areas and similar agro-ecologies of chickpea growing areas in Ethiopia.
